1. POST CONTEXT

The Joint Logistics Support Group Headquarters commands and controls assigned logistic, Engineer and medical units for the execution of JTF’s operational level plan.

The Support Branch is responsible for the support of JLSG HQ mission execution.

The Communication and Information System Section (CIS) develops and coordinates CIS plans and concepts in support for operational (COPs / OPLANs) CIS support for the JLSG HQ.

The incumbent is responsible for CIS support of the Joint Logistics Support Group HQ (JLSG HQ).

The incumbent reports to the Branch Head (Support) OF-5.

2. DUTIES

The Section Head's duties are:

  • To act as the Head of the CIS Section of JLSG HQ. He / She is directly subordinated to the Branch Head (Support).
  • Be responsible for advising COS JLSG HQ on all CIS matters and for co-ordination on all decisions on CIS issues.
  • To provide support in developing tactical plans, concepts, procedures and training of JLSG HQ.
  • Be responsible for coordination and preparation of CIS Annexes of JLSG GRPs and OPLANs.
  • To ensure CIS supporting JLSG HQ and subordinate units are available and supportable to meet deployed Information Exchange Requirements (IERs).
  • To monitor current CIS situation with JLSG subordinate units in JLS AOR, maintain own CIS situational awareness when JLSG HQ is activated and deployed and report JLSG CIS Situation and CIS related incidents to the higher HQs.
  • To advise COS JLSG on the solution of CIS and Cyber related issues and to act to resolve the CIS related incidents.
  • To act as the point of contact between the JLSG Staff and the CIS providing elements (NCISG, NCIA or others).
  • To coordinate, in close coordination with the provider, the deployment of NATO CIS within the JLSG HQ and subordinate units.
  • To ensure overall efficient operation of all assigned CIS assets with support of CIS providing element.
  • To supervise the settlement of CIS assets within JLSG HQ in close coordination with Section Head Information Management.
  • To coordinate and supervise Cyber Defence, INFOSEC and Frequency Management issues in JLSG.

The incumbent may be required to perform like duties elsewhere within the organization as directed.

The incumbent is required to undertake operation deployments and/or TDY assignments both within and outside NATO's boundaries.

The work is normally performed in a Normal NATO office working environment / secure office environment with artificial light and air (e.g. Bunker).

Normal Working Conditions apply. The risk of injury is categorized as: No risk / risk might increase when deployed.

5. CONTRACT

The successful candidate will receive a two-year definite duration contract. NATO International Civilians will be offered a contract in accordance with the provision of the NCPRs.

The basic entry-level monthly salary for a NATO Grade 17 (A-3) in Italy is Euro 6,536.34 which may be augmented by allowances based on the selected staff member’s eligibility, and which is subject to the withholding of approximately 20% for pension and medical insurance contributions.

Please note:

Staff members are appointed to and hold posts on the establishment of a NATO body only on condition that:

  • They are nationals of a NATO member country

  • They are over 21 and under 60 years of age at the time of taking up their appointments. Appointments of definite duration may be offered to candidates of 60 years of age or more, provided that the expiry date of the contract is not later than the date at which the candidate attains the age of 65.

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ION:

A NATO security clearance and approval of the candidate’s medical file by the NATO Medical Adviser are essential conditions for appointment to this post. Applicants are not required to possess a clearance at the time of applying, but they must be eligible for a clearance. HQ JFC Naples will take action to obtain the required security clearance from the successful candidates’ national authorities.
